Global Propylene Carbonate Market Forecast 2026–2036: Market Expansion Driven by Battery-Linked Demand

<p>The global <a href="https://www.futuremarketinsights.com/reports/propylene-carbonate-market">propylene carbonate market</a> is projected to witness strong expansion over the next decade, supported by skyrocketing demand for high-performance electrolyte solvents and rapid industrialization. The market is expected to grow steadily, reaching approximately USD 3.1 billion by 2036, registering a CAGR of 5.6%, according to the latest analysis by Future Market Insights (FMI).</p><p>Market growth is being shaped by increasing application in lithium-ion battery production, growing consumer demand for electronics, and rapid adoption of advanced chemical processing technologies. Propylene carbonate has evolved from a broad industrial solvent into an essential component for energy storage systems and specialized electronics manufacturing. While traditional industrial grades continue to command a large market footprint, manufacturers are increasingly prioritizing electronic-grade formulations to meet ultra-high purity requirements and improve electrochemical performance outcomes.</p><p><strong>Global Propylene Carbonate Market Snapshot (2026–2036)</strong></p><p>Market value outlook in 2026: USD 1.8 billion</p><p>Market forecast value toward 2036: USD 3.1 billion</p><p>Forecast CAGR (2026–2036): 5.6%</p><p>Dominant application category: Industrial grade solvent uses</p><p>Fastest-growing segment: Lithium-ion battery application (~38.4% share in 2026)</p><p>Key growth countries: South Korea, China, Japan, USA, Germany</p><p>Primary demand channel: Battery and electronics manufacturing services</p><p><strong>Momentum in the Market</strong></p><p>Beginning from steady industrial adoption levels, the global propylene carbonate market demonstrates accelerated growth throughout the forecast period as battery-linked chemical demand becomes prominent across multiple countries. Propylene carbonate serves as a critical electrolyte solvent, driving spending across the energy storage sector to meet electric vehicle and grid needs.</p><p><strong>Growth of Electronics and Semiconductor Production</strong></p><p>Rapid expansion of high-tech manufacturing hubs requires ultra-high purity and low-moisture chemical inputs. This boosts the integration of electronic-grade solvents within electronics manufacturing services.</p><p><strong>Focus on Electrochemical Stability and Performance</strong></p><p>Industrial facilities are prioritizing chemicals that provide superior thermal properties and reliable performance under volatile processing conditions, ensuring higher product safety and efficiency.</p><p><strong>Top Segment Application Type</strong></p><p><strong>Lithium-ion Batteries Lead Market Demand</strong></p><p>Lithium-ion batteries account for a significant portion of propylene carbonate installations, holding a projected 38.4% share of the application segment in 2026. This is heavily supported by rising EV battery infrastructure globally.</p><p><strong>Grade Type Analysis</strong></p><p>Industrial grade: ~61.7% market share in 2026, reflecting major volume use where cost-effective solvent performance with standard purity is required.</p><p>Electronic grade: ~28.9% market share, growing rapidly due to strict low-moisture specifications in semiconductor fabrication.</p><p>Pharmaceutical grade: Serving specialized medical and topical chemical formulations requiring strict regulatory compliance.</p><p><strong>Regional Development: Global Manufacturing Hubs Drive Expansion</strong></p><p>The global supply landscape is rapidly evolving, supported by expanding chemical processing clusters and rising regional manufacturing demands.</p><p>South Korea: The regional growth leader, recording the fastest country-level expansion at a 6.8% CAGR through 2036, driven by intense battery program developments.</p><p>China: Expanding assembly and specialty chemical capabilities, tracking closely at a 6.1% CAGR.</p><p>Japan: Focused heavily on premium chemical grades, recording a 5.7% CAGR backed by advanced manufacturing technology.</p><p>USA and Germany: Leading western demand centers with a 5.2% and 4.8% CAGR respectively, supported by strong quality standards and automotive transformations.</p><p><strong>Challenges, Trends, Opportunities, and Drivers</strong></p><p><strong>Drivers</strong></p><p>Expansion of lithium-ion battery manufacturing programs</p><p>Growing electronics and semiconductor fabrication services</p><p>Rising demand for high-performance industrial solvents</p><p>Development of quality-controlled chemical supply chains</p><p><strong>Opportunities</strong></p><p>Ultra-high purity and electronic-grade formulations</p><p>Integration with next-generation electric vehicle battery packs</p><p>Advanced localization of processing centers</p><p>Supplying stable chemical specifications to build buyer confidence</p><p><strong>Trends</strong></p><p>Transition toward low-moisture chemical solutions</p><p>Adoption of advanced purification technologies</p><p>Increasing dominance of battery-linked chemical demand</p><p>Focus on cost-effective but premium thermal properties</p><p><strong>Challenges</strong></p><p>Cost considerations for entry-level industrial grades</p><p>Complex purity control and moisture requirements</p><p>Adapting to evolving regional safety and transport standards</p><p><strong>The Competitive Environment</strong></p><p>The global propylene carbonate market is moderately consolidated, with global safety and chemical technology providers competing through manufacturing efficiency, scale, and localized supply chains.
